Robert A. Hensel

December 9, 1946 — May 18, 2026

Strasburg, Ohio

Robert A. “Bob” Hensel, 79, of Strasburg, passed away unexpectedly at his home on Monday, May 18, 2026.

Born on December 9, 1946, in Dover, Bob was the son of the late Cletus and Kathryn (Mosher) Hensel. He was also preceded in death by his sisters, Virginia Deuker, Mary Malcuit, Betty Flatley, Diane Harper, Mildred Davis, and his brother, Gene Hensel.

A 1964 graduate of Strasburg High School, Bob began his career at Cummins Diesel in Strasburg. He later served as service manager at Columbus Equipment in Cadiz before founding RH Equipment in Strasburg, which he operated for many years with the help of his sons. Seeking a new challenge, he worked for International Service and Rental in Nassau, Bahamas. Following the events of September 11, 2001, he and his wife, Rita, returned to the United States, settling in Florida where Bob worked as equipment manager for Swell Construction until his retirement in 2015 after a 51-year career. Bob was a longtime member of First Lutheran Church in Strasburg, where he served on council and as an usher. He remained active in the community as a member of the Strasburg Lions Club and as Worshipful Master of the former Cypress Lodge #604 F & AM in Strasburg. An outdoorsman, Bob enjoyed golf, motorcycle riding, boating, and camping. He and Rita were members of the Buckeye Bacon Burners and the Swiss Wheelers, and he even gave country line dancing a try.

He is survived by his wife of 61 years, Rita (Fishel) Hensel, whom he married on August 21, 1964; sons, Bob (Shelly) Hensel of Tappen Lake and Rick (Robin) Hensel of Centerburg; siblings, Bill Hensel of Strasburg, Wanda Wells of Columbus, and Carol Murphy of Dover; grandchildren, Emily (Chris) Mann, Clete (Kristen) Hensel, Magie (Tanner) Leyda, Rhett (Amanda) Hensel, and Reed (Dana) Hensel; great-grandchildren, Brant, Ross, and Riley; brother-in-law, Jim Harper; and sister-in-law, Vina Hensel, both of Strasburg.
